## tailr — Internal Log Tailing CLI

Welcome to the Quillback platform team. We use `tailr` to stream logs from staging and prod. Install it via the internal package feed, then run `tailr init` once. Common flags: `-f` to follow, `-s` to filter by service, `--since` for time windows. Prod access requires the on-call role. The tool caches session metadata in a small Postgres instance; `tailr init` will prompt for credentials, and for staging you should use the connection string below.

database URL for tajog-bajeg: mysql://soreth_svc:OzsCjhu@db-6997.nelvrostack.internal:5432/kelax

Visitor Policy — Fire Drill (Night Shift): During a night-time fire drill at Halden Works, all visitors must be escorted by their host to Assembly Point B and included in the roll call. Hosts answer for their visitors by name; unaccounted visitors are reported to the warden at once. After the all-clear, visitors re-enter only through the main door using the night pass below.

door code, yagap-bahof: bdg-O-05

## Configuration

The v2.4.1 patch fixes the Lanternfish session-token refresh loop. Tokens now rotate on schedule instead of every request. Set REFRESH_WINDOW_SECONDS to 900 and redeploy both gateway nodes before tagging the release. In the production env file, append the token-signing secret on the line below this one.

vault entry, kajop-tajog: RELAY_SECRET20=9d8c03c2fb7d206bcf8d